South Korea Seismic Support Market By Type Segment Analysis

The South Korea seismic support market can be classified into several key segments based on the type of seismic support solutions, primarily encompassing seismic isolation systems, damping devices, base isolators, and seismic retrofit components. Among these, seismic isolation systems—comprising base isolators and seismic dampers—are the dominant segment, accounting for approximately 60% of the total market share. These systems are designed to absorb and dissipate seismic energy, thereby protecting critical infrastructure such as government buildings, commercial complexes, and transportation hubs. The damping devices segment, including tuned mass dampers and viscous dampers, is witnessing rapid adoption owing to their cost-effectiveness and ease of integration into existing structures.
